ValueError: could not broadcast input array from shape (100,100,3) into shape (100,100)
解决方案:
# img=io.imread(im)
改成
img = cv2.imread(im)
TensorFlow训练报错
最新推荐文章于 2024-09-29 14:13:49 发布
文章讨论了一个在处理图像时遇到的ValueError,即尝试将一个形状为(100,100,3)的数组广播到形状为(100,100)的数组时出错。解决方案是使用OpenCV的cv2.imread()函数代替原代码中的io.imread()来读取图像,因为OpenCV在处理RGB图像时能正确处理额外的色彩通道。
摘要由CSDN通过智能技术生成